Modal analysis of back-to-back planetary gear: Experiments and correlation against lumped-parameter mode

Abstract

In order to characterize the dynamic behaviour of a back-to-back planetary gear, experimental and numerical modal analysis techniques are achieved. Rotational and translational modal deflections are highlighted. Natural frequencies are compared to the results from the lumped-parameter model. The modes are presented in the numerical studies in low-frequency and high-frequency bands. Distributions of modal kinetic and strain energies are studied.This paper was financially supported by the Tunisian-Spanish Joint Project No. A1/037038/11.
